What the Sunflower County Farm Data Shows

Sunflower County, Mississippi reported 301 farm operations in the 2022 USDA Census of Agriculture, generating $349.3M in total commodity sales and receiving $7.3M in federal farm program payments. Net cash farm income for the county came in at $87.2M, which ranks the county #2 of 82 counties in Mississippi by commodity sales. These are not sample surveys or rolling averages — they are the consolidated returns of every farm operation that NASS enumerators counted at the parcel level for the 2022 Census, the most comprehensive snapshot of US agriculture that the federal government produces.

Land use patterns in the county tell the deeper story. Of the 381,831 acres in agricultural land, 347,311 acres is cropland (91.0% of ag land), with the balance in pasture, rangeland, woodland, or farmsteads. Average farm size sits at 1,269 acres, a figure that signals whether the local industry is dominated by large commercial operations or by smaller family farms — a distinction that directly shapes which USDA programs flow into the county and how eligible operators qualify for conservation, insurance, and disaster assistance.

Land Use Breakdown

Agricultural land use breakdown for Sunflower County, Mississippi (2022 USDA Census of Agriculture)
Category Acres Share of Ag Land
Total agricultural land 381,831 100.0%
Cropland 347,311 91.0%
Pasture, range, woodland, other 34,520 9.0%
Average farm size 1,269 acres / farm
